This book focuses on plastics applications in packaging. It offers detailed descriptions of the properties of the major packaging plastics as well as descriptions of the major processes for forming plastics as they relate to packaging applications. Guidance on selection of polymers, processing methods, package types, and shelf life estimates is provided. The book is also intended as a text book/self study guide and includes sample questions for students.

John D. Culter, Ph.D., is President of Advanced Materials Engineering, Inc., and has worked in the plastics packaging industry since the early 1970s. He has developed and taught several courses in polymer packaging at Michigan State University and the Missouri University of Science and Technology, as well as in Brazil and Argentina, and online.
